[交流] 【求助】多层膜反射率的计算

多层膜反射率的计算过程中,在第一个界面出射的光进入第二个界面时有个相位延迟,这个相位延迟在不同的课本上有两种表示方法,应该是说完全不同两种表述方法,有的书上是2*PI/lamata  *n*d*cos(theta), theta 是折射角,lamata 是波长,而有的书上是除以 cos(theta),我认为是应该后者,各位虫友们发表下意见吧!

all these two expressions are correct BUT NOT THE SAME.

(using your words)
An incident beam line is divided into two parts, the deflected and refracted, at an interface  between the media #1 and #2. Your expression of 2*PI/lamata  *n*d*cos(theta) is the TOTAL PHASE DIFFERENCE between these two beam lines in the media #1, which includes two parts, the phase lapse of the refracted beam line in media #2 (=2*PI *n*d*/[lamata*cos(theta)]), and the phase lapse of the deflected beam line in media #1 (=2*n*d*tan(theta)*sin(theta)).

Therefore, the expression of 2*PI *n*d*/[lamata*cos(theta)], which you found in some other textbooks, is only a phase lapse of the refracted beam line in media #2.
